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6799 746 940512586 174698
42977797 5710037
42977797 5710037
21694934 2747397343 614289 615902
All about undefined
Interested in learning more?
42977797 5710037
21694934 2747397343 614289 615902
See more
526483357 400646611 07963797
0610049 8686 451 27105
See more
65678981099 2582981678
2319 449734147 413
See more